#3863ff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3863ff is composed of 22% red, 38.8%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78% cyan, 61.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 227 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 61%. #3863ff color hex could be obtained by blending #70c6ff with #0000ff.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#3863ff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3863ff has RGB values of R:56, G:99,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.61,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 3695615.

Shades and Tints of #3863ff
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000411 is the darkest color, while #fcf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#3863ff
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9497a3 is the less saturated color, while #3863ff is the most saturated one.
